On the modeling of a sonic liner subjected to acoustic loads
Keywords:
Sonic liner, Auxetic material, Sound attenuation, Full band-gap.
Abstract
The sound attenuation in a sonic liner consisted of an array of acoustic scatterers embedded into an epoxy matrix and subjected to acoustic loads are studied in this paper. The scatterers are spherical shells made from the auxetic material (with negative Poisson's ratio). The size effect of the auxetic cells upon the formation of a full band-gap is investigated and controlled by geometric transformations.
